It is the policy of the City of Los Angeles to provide access to its programs and services for persons with disabilities in accordance with Title II of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) of 1990. Oversight of compliance activities is the responsibility of the ADA Compliance Officer and all inquiries concerning the City's efforts to make its programs and services accessible to persons with disabilities should be directed to Department on Disability, Disability Access and Services,333 South Spring Street, Los Angeles, CA 90013, (213) 847-9124 or (213) 847-9123 Voice and (213) 847-6560 TDD. The City of Los Angeles has established, pursuant to Title II, Section 35.107 (B) of the ADA, the following formal grievance procedure to be used by persons with disabilities to allege violations of the ADA. Individuals are not required by federal regulations to use this grievance procedure, but may file complaints directly with the appropriate federal enforcement agency. Under the City's Discrimination Complaint Procedure (Attachment A), employees of the City and applicants for City employment have the right to file a written discrimination complaint with the Civil Service Commission within one year of an alleged act of discrimination. The complaint may be filed on any employment action, procedure, or practice specifically affecting the individual, which is believed to be discriminatory, including any allegation of employment-related discrimination under Title I of the ADA. All such complaints are investigated by staff of the Personnel Department's Equal Employment Opportunities Section, Employee Services Division.s
